Key Responsibilities:

  • As Senior Administrator, you will play a key role within the client services and operations team, with duties including:
  • Processing new business submissions across pensions, investments, and protection cases, ensuring accuracy and compliance.
  • Acting as the first point of contact for queries from Financial Advisers, clients, and providers.
  • Managing the deceased client process with care, liaising with executors and providers to close cases efficiently.
  • Supporting with commission queries, direct debit issues, and policy updates.
  • Monitoring shared inboxes and ensuring queries are handled within SLAs.
  • Overseeing the compliance file process, ensuring accurate scanning and documentation.
  • Managing Letters of Authority (LOAs), pension forecasts, and Attitude to Risk processes using tools like Dynamic Planner.
  • Ensuring Know Your Client (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) documentation is up to date.
  • Annual review and cleansing of hard copy client files.

Ideal Candidate:

  • Previous experience in Wealth Management, IFA administration, or Financial Planning support.
  • Highly organised, detail-oriented, and able to manage multiple tasks.
  • Confident communicator with experience handling client and provider queries.
  • Knowledge of financial products such as pensions, ISAs, and life policies.
  • Strong IT skills and comfortable using back-office systems (e.g., Intelligent Office).
